Wentworth:
Britain's Darren Clarke has a one-stroke lead at the halfway stage of the Volvo PGA Championship at Wentworth in England. Clarke followed up his 66 opening round with a 69 on Friday and that was good enough to give him a one shot lead over Niclas Fasth of Sweden - with another four players a further stroke behind. The second round was a good one for Nick Faldo. A birdie at the 18th was one of seven in his round of 68 - and that gave him a halfway total of 139 - five under par. His former Ryder Cup teammate, Colin Montgomerie, also picked up a birdie at the last in his round of 70 - taking him too to five under for the two rounds. The two Britons are a stroke behind Trevor Immelman of South Africa. Immelman himself is a stroke behind Kenneth Ferrie of England and Soren Hansen of Denmark. (AP)
